Baseball Drops Series Finale To Holy Family
Philadelphia, PA - Felician came up short against Holy Family on Monday, falling 6–3 despite putting together 11 hits and creating opportunities across the later innings. Felician finished with three runs on 11 hits, generating consistent traffic but struggling to convert in key moments. The game turned early in the second inning, where Holy Family capitalized on a cluster of baserunners to build a four-run lead.
